Output 44b9c2c09d748c465c04966d2c9a674697ab86a9513d7b6a8a25a96df2bcbe7b:3

value
8905063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86636f3cbae3cb03d18c6be9ed91ac1eb440220b OP_EQUAL
address
3Dwbb5dVFqTn1gwsuk8E1qAEFnrqj31NWL
transaction
44b9c2c09d748c465c04966d2c9a674697ab86a9513d7b6a8a25a96df2bcbe7b
confirmations
342347
spent
true